Output 56105d94eeecd2263568349732656c048ed3c5f274915696100cfd5c012d7146:88

value
64465
script pubkey
OP_0 OP_PUSHBYTES_20 211e543da873ddbfb2e23ceb85dd765d1d1bd137
address
bc1qyy09g0dgw0wmlvhz8n4cthtkt5w3h5fh97yvx8
transaction
56105d94eeecd2263568349732656c048ed3c5f274915696100cfd5c012d7146
confirmations
168012
spent
true